Antony Berg

Antony Berg (8 August 1880 – 18 April 1948) was a French bobsledder. He competed in the four-man event at the 1924 Winter Olympics. Berg earned a Military Cross for fighting in World War I, and in 1928, he became an Officier of the Legion of Honour. Provided by Wikipedia
